Analysis
In 2024, groundnuts, excluding shelled — gross per capita production index in Vanuatu stood at 58.58.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 118.7% on the previous year and down 42.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, groundnuts, excluding shelled — gross per capita production index in Vanuatu peaked at 142.4 in 1981 and was at its lowest, 25.44, in 1964.
That places Vanuatu 88th out of 104 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 64 years of available data.

About this data
The FAO indices of agricultural production show the relative level of the aggregate volume of agricultural production for each year in comparison with the base period 2014-2016. Indices for meat production are computed based on data on production from indigenous animals.
